Advocacy -  Ability Resources provides information and support to consumers, schools and businesses concerning legal and civil rights such as those stipulated in the Americans with Disabilities Act, the Individuals with Disabilities Act and the Rehabilitation Act. We also help consumers secure benefits from public institutions. In addition, Ability Resources helps focus the attention of the community on quality-of-life issues of special importance to people with disabilities. Also available is information about pending local and national legislation and how to contact legislators .

Benefits Planning-  Ability Resources educates consumers about how working may affect their Socialy Security Income and/or Social Security Dissability Insurance benefits.

Case Management-   Since 1994, Ability Resources has provided case management services under the ADvantage Program. As a case management agency, Ability Resources coordinates the services that consumers who are at high risk of premature entry into nursing homes need to remain in the community. These services include personal-care assistance, homemaker services, home-delivered meals, physical therapy, home modifications, equipment, prescriptions, etc. Ability Resources' case managers, with their knowledge of the available resources, experience in service delivery to people with disabilities, and familiarity with the federal and state system, provide this service to approximately 200 consumers in the northeastern section of the state.

Independent Living Counseling - Our Independent Living counselors provide assistance to individuals in finding: accessible housing, medical equipment/supplies,and emergency assistance,  as well as providing applications for programs through the Department of Human Services, the Department of Rehabilitaiton Services, the Social Security Administration, and others.  We also offer independent living assessments through the VA, and résumé critiques.

Multicultural Outreach-  Provides services to individuals with disabilities and their families  from multicultural backgrounds. Our Spanish speaking counselor assists individuals in  finding medical equipment and supplies, locating accessible housing,  providing and obtaining counseling and finding related information. Individuals can also receive help applying for benefits.

Transportation-  Learn to use the city bus, apply to see if you are eligible for the curb-to-curb LIFT program, or apply for the Transportation Assistance for Seniors Program. Ability Resources has teaching and monitoring programs to support these services.
